Header banner
Revain logoHome Page
Michael Skerving photo
1 Уровень
802 Отзыва
32 Карма

Отзыв о IZOKEE 0.96'' I2C IIC 12864 128X64 пиксельный OLED ЖК-дисплей Shield Board Module 4 Пин для Arduino & Raspberry Pi - Набор из 3 штук (Желто-синий-IIC) от Michael Skerving

Revainrating 4 out of 5

Отличный OLED-дисплей - прост в использовании

Это отличный OLED-дисплей, с которым очень легко работать. Использование библиотек Adafruit делает это очень простым. Некоторые основные коды показаны ниже. Некоторая дополнительная информация, которая может оказаться полезной: > Потребляемый ток для режима 128x32: 14,7 мА (логотип Adafruit), 4,4 мА (4 строки размера 1), 4,5 мА (2 строки размера 1), 10,6 мА (2 строки размера 2). ). линий), < 10 мкА (дисплей выключен) > Потребляемый ток в режиме 128x64: 10,5 мА (логотип Adafruit), 3,3 мА (размер 4 строки1), 3,3 мА (размер 2 строки1), 6,6 мА (размер 2 строки2), < 10 мкА ( дисплей выключен)/************************* ВКЛЮЧАЕТ ********** ********** * **************** /#include <Wire.h>#include <Adafruit_GFX.h>#include <Adafruit_SSD1306.h>/* *** ******* *** ************** ОПРЕДЕЛЕНИЯ ********************** *** ***** *** ***/// Объявление для дисплея SSD1306, подключенного к I2C (контакты SDA, SCL)// Для Arduino Uno R3 SDA — это контакт A4, а SCL — контакт A5#define OLED_RESET -1 // Сбросить номер контакта (или -1, если Используется Arduino Shared Reset Pin)// Adafruit_SSD1306 Display(128, 32, &Wire, OLED_RESET); Adafruit_SSD1306 Display(128, 64, &wire, OLED_RESET);/ ***************************** *SETUP***** * ** ***************************** / Void setup () { Serial.begin (57600); // SSD1306_SWITCHCAPVCC = генерирует внутреннее напряжение дисплея 3,3 В if (!display.begin(SSD1306_SWITCHCAPVCC, 0x3c)) {Serial.println(F("Ошибка отображения SS1306")); Пер (;;); // Не продолжать, бесконечный цикл }}/************************************ MAIN ****** * ** ** * *********************/void loop() { // базовое отображение четырех строк delay(500); // Пауза на 0,5 секунды display.clearDisplay(); дисплей.setTextSize (1); display.setTextColor (БЕЛЫЙ); display.setCursor (0, 0); display.println("Строка 1"); display.println("Строка 2"); display.println("Строка 3"); display.println("Строка 4"); дисплей.дисплей(); задержка(4000); // Пауза на 4 секунды // Выключаем дисплей display.clearDisplay(); дисплей.дисплей(); display.ssd1306_command (SSD1306_DISPLAYOFF); // включить отображение display.ssd1306_command(SSD1306_DISPLAYON);}

Плюсы
  • Лучший
Минусы
  • Уродливая упаковка

Комментарии (0)

Please, sign in to write a comment